Condividi tramite


az containerapp compose

Nota

Questo gruppo di comandi include comandi definiti sia nell'interfaccia della riga di comando di Azure che in almeno un'estensione. Installare ogni estensione per trarre vantaggio dalle funzionalità estese. Altre informazioni sulle estensioni.

Comandi per creare app di Azure Container da specifiche compose.

Comandi

Nome Descrizione Tipo Stato
az containerapp compose create

Creare una o più app contenitore in un ambiente app contenitore nuovo o esistente da una specifica Compose.

Memoria centrale Disponibilità generale
az containerapp compose create (containerapp estensione)

Creare una o più app contenitore in un ambiente app contenitore nuovo o esistente da una specifica Compose.

Estensione Disponibilità generale

az containerapp compose create

Creare una o più app contenitore in un ambiente app contenitore nuovo o esistente da una specifica Compose.

az containerapp compose create --environment
                               --resource-group
                               [--compose-file-path]
                               [--location]
                               [--registry-password]
                               [--registry-server]
                               [--registry-username]
                               [--tags]
                               [--transport]
                               [--transport-mapping]

Esempio

Creare un'app contenitore passando in modo implicito un file di configurazione Compose dalla directory corrente.

az containerapp compose create -g MyResourceGroup \
    --environment MyContainerappEnv

Creare un'app contenitore passando in modo esplicito un file di configurazione compose.

az containerapp compose create -g MyResourceGroup \
    --environment MyContainerappEnv \
    --compose-file-path "path/to/docker-compose.yml"

Parametri necessari

--environment

Nome o ID risorsa dell'ambiente dell'app contenitore.

--resource-group -g

Nome del gruppo di risorse. È possibile configurare il gruppo predefinito con az configure --defaults group=<name>.

Parametri facoltativi

--compose-file-path -f

Percorso di un file Docker Compose con la configurazione da importare in App Contenitore di Azure.

valore predefinito: ./docker-compose.yml
--location -l

Posizione. Usare i valori ottenuti con az account list-locations. È possibile configurare la posizione predefinito con az configure --defaults location=<location>.

--registry-password

Password per accedere al registro contenitori. Se archiviato come segreto, il valore deve iniziare con 'secretref:' seguito dal nome del segreto.

--registry-server

Nome host del server del registro contenitori, ad esempio myregistry.azurecr.io.

--registry-username

Nome utente in cui accedere al registro contenitori.

--tags

Tag separati da spazi: key[=value] [key[=value] ...]. Usare "" per cancellare i tag esistenti.

--transport
Deprecato

L'opzione '--transport' è stata deprecata e verrà rimossa in una versione futura. Usare invece '--transport-mapping'.

Opzioni di trasporto per istanza dell'app contenitore (servicename=transportsetting).

--transport-mapping

Opzioni di trasporto per istanza dell'app contenitore (servicename=transportsetting).

Parametri globali
--debug

Aumenta il livello di dettaglio della registrazione per mostrare tutti i log di debug.

--help -h

Visualizza questo messaggio della guida ed esce.

--only-show-errors

Mostra solo gli errori, eliminando gli avvisi.

--output -o

Formato di output.

valori accettati: json, jsonc, none, table, tsv, yaml, yamlc
valore predefinito: json
--query

Stringa di query JMESPath. Per altre informazioni ed esempi, vedere http://jmespath.org/.

--subscription

Nome o ID della sottoscrizione. È possibile configurare la sottoscrizione predefinita usando az account set -s NAME_OR_ID.

--verbose

Aumenta il livello di dettaglio della registrazione. Usare --debug per log di debug completi.

az containerapp compose create (containerapp estensione)

Creare una o più app contenitore in un ambiente app contenitore nuovo o esistente da una specifica Compose.

az containerapp compose create --environment
                               --resource-group
                               [--compose-file-path]
                               [--location]
                               [--registry-password]
                               [--registry-server]
                               [--registry-username]
                               [--tags]
                               [--transport]
                               [--transport-mapping]

Esempio

Creare un'app contenitore passando in modo implicito un file di configurazione Compose dalla directory corrente.

az containerapp compose create -g MyResourceGroup \
    --environment MyContainerappEnv

Creare un'app contenitore passando in modo esplicito un file di configurazione compose.

az containerapp compose create -g MyResourceGroup \
    --environment MyContainerappEnv \
    --compose-file-path "path/to/docker-compose.yml"

Parametri necessari

--environment

Nome o ID risorsa dell'ambiente dell'app contenitore.

--resource-group -g

Nome del gruppo di risorse. È possibile configurare il gruppo predefinito con az configure --defaults group=<name>.

Parametri facoltativi

--compose-file-path -f

Percorso di un file Docker Compose con la configurazione da importare in App Contenitore di Azure.

valore predefinito: ./docker-compose.yml
--location -l

Posizione. Usare i valori ottenuti con az account list-locations. È possibile configurare la posizione predefinito con az configure --defaults location=<location>.

--registry-password

Password per accedere al registro contenitori. Se archiviato come segreto, il valore deve iniziare con 'secretref:' seguito dal nome del segreto.

--registry-server

Nome host del server del registro contenitori, ad esempio myregistry.azurecr.io.

--registry-username

Nome utente in cui accedere al registro contenitori.

--tags

Tag separati da spazi: key[=value] [key[=value] ...]. Usare "" per cancellare i tag esistenti.

--transport
Deprecato

L'opzione '--transport' è stata deprecata e verrà rimossa in una versione futura. Usare invece '--transport-mapping'.

Opzioni di trasporto per istanza dell'app contenitore (servicename=transportsetting).

--transport-mapping

Opzioni di trasporto per istanza dell'app contenitore (servicename=transportsetting).

Parametri globali
--debug

Aumenta il livello di dettaglio della registrazione per mostrare tutti i log di debug.

--help -h

Visualizza questo messaggio della guida ed esce.

--only-show-errors

Mostra solo gli errori, eliminando gli avvisi.

--output -o

Formato di output.

valori accettati: json, jsonc, none, table, tsv, yaml, yamlc
valore predefinito: json
--query

Stringa di query JMESPath. Per altre informazioni ed esempi, vedere http://jmespath.org/.

--subscription

Nome o ID della sottoscrizione. È possibile configurare la sottoscrizione predefinita usando az account set -s NAME_OR_ID.

--verbose

Aumenta il livello di dettaglio della registrazione. Usare --debug per log di debug completi.